Lite Version Limitations

Top  Previous  Next

Starting in version 3.21 of DONATION, there are two variant versions of it available - the full, paid version, and the free, Lite version. If you are not sure which version you have, go to Help à About DONATION in the program. If it says "Free Lite Version", "Free Lite Local Database Version" or "Free Lite Standalone Version" on the line underneath the version number, then it's the Lite version. If it says anything else there, it isn't.

 

Paid Version

 

The full, paid version has all of the features documented in this manual, and also allows for the option of using a multi-user network version of DONATION on a local area network within one workplace. It starts out as a 60-day evaluation version (which has all features except for creating real charitable receipts), and is changed to the full version when you pay the Initial Purchase price and get a license key for the program. Lite Version

 

The free, Lite version of DONATION has all of the core features that are needed to track donors and donations and issue receipts. It can be used by smaller charities and churches with more limited needs.

 

The Lite version can always be upgraded to the paid full version if you wish, by installing the full version from the DOWNLOAD page on the web site or via the Tools à Check for Updates menu option, which will give you the 60-day evaluation version. Then paying the Initial Purchase price entitles you to a license key, which converts the evaluation version to the full version.

 

Limitations

 

The following are the limitations of the free Lite version:

 

It can only have up to 100 donors with donations in each year.
The One Date Batch Entry window, which helps churches enter the Sunday collection more quickly, is not supported.
It does not have special receipts for Gifts in Kind for Canadian users, and as a result the Description field cannot be displayed for donation details, since it is mostly used for recording the description of Gifts in Kind.
Several Donor Details fields are eliminated: the Email Address field, the three renamable Other Info fields, and the Comments field. Since the email address field is removed, emailing donors and emailing receipts are both also removed, as is the Email Sending Configuration option.
Email Backups and Internet backups are not supported.
Only simple annual pledging is supported.
The Limited User password (used in churches for counters or tellers to record donations, seeing only envelope numbers but not names) cannot be used.
Configuring and creating bank deposits is not supported - you can instead just use various reports to help understand what is in your bank deposit.
The Letters menu options for mail-merge letters and receipts are not available. Of course, the standard built-in receipts are still available.
Custom Reports and Memorized Reports are not available, though all of the built-in reports are still available.
From the Receipt menu, the All Donors and Filtered Donors options are not available, so receipts must be created one donor at a time.
From the Database menu, the following options are not available: all Importing options, Reassign Envelope Numbers, Merge Duplicate Donors, Change Date of Donations (mostly only needed if you could use One Date Batch Entry), Switch Databases, and SQL Select.

 

The Lite version does not need and cannot use the license keys that are required by the full version. Thus, the Tools à Request or Install License Key menu option is not needed by the Lite version.

 

Support

 

Users of the Lite version are entitled to free support for installation and startup issues for one month from the date on which they register the program, via the REGISTER page on the web site or the Register Online form in the program. After that, however, a small annual support fee will be required if you need support - see the PRICING/PAYMENT page on the web for details.
